After Day 2 of the BKT World Men’s Curling Championship at the Temple Gardens Centre in Moose Jaw, Canada, China and Scotland are the only remaining undefeated teams.

Canada had the bye during Sunday evening’s draw, but China and Scotland each picked up wins.

China was leading Italy 6-4 heading into the ninth end before scoring three points to make the final 9-4.

Meanwhile, Korea held tough against the Scots. Scotland only held a 6-3 lead heading into the ninth end. They also scored three for a 9-3 win.

The marquee matchup heading into Monday will be in the afternoon when Canada and Scotland meet in a battle for first place.

In other games on Sunday night, Norway scored three in the third and stole another two in the fourth end en route to an 8-3 win over Germany.

Additionally, Sweden and Austria went back and forth, exchanging single points until Sweden scored two in the seventh end and three in the ninth end for an 8-4 win.
